Bulls Sign Trevor Hendrikx
San Francisco, Calif. – The San Francisco Bulls Professional Hockey Team, proud affiliate of the San Jose Sharks, announced today the signing of defenseman Trevor Hendrikx. The Bulls have a total of 10 players, including three defensemen on their inaugural 2012-13 season roster.
“Trevor is another good addition to our defensive unit that we anticipate to be a solid shut down group,” said SF Bulls President and Head Coach Pat Curcio. “Knowing Trevor from the OHL, and having the luxury of coaching him in a tournament in Europe, I’m confident he’ll be one of the top all-around defensemen in the ECHL this season.” Hendrikx, 27, brings six years of professional experience to the Bulls’ backline. The 6-foot, 2-inch, 205-pound blueliner played last season with Allen of the Central Hockey League (CHL) and Hamilton of the American Hockey League (AHL). Hendrikx recorded 14 points (5 goals, 9 assists) and 136 penalty minutes in 45 games with Allen. A native of Russell, Ontario, Hendrikx twice led Johnstown of the ECHL in points with 164 in 2009-10 and 145 in 2008-09. In 221 career ECHL games, Hendrikx has recorded 95 points (30 goals, 65 assists) and 625 penalty minutes. Hendrikx was twice drafted by the Columbus Blue Jackets, most recently in the seventh round, 201st overall, of the 2005 NHL Entry Draft. He helped lead Peterborough of the Ontario Hockey League (OHL) to the championship and the Memorial Cup. He ranked first in defense scoring on Peterborough his final two seasons (2004-06). “I’m excited to join the Bulls organization,” said Hendrikx. “We’re putting together a good team and have a great coach. It’s a good operation, and I’m excited to get the season started. It’s great for San Francisco to get a team back. We’re going to put a good product on the ice and will hopefully get a good turnout at the games.” |
